Model Perencanaan Tata Ruang Partisipatif untuk Pengembangan Heritage Education Tourism di Situs Cagar Budaya Kota Kapur Kabupaten Bangka
Bibliographic record
Abstract
Situs Cagar Budaya Kota Kapur di Kabupaten Bangka memiliki nilai historis tinggi sebagai pusat peradaban Sriwijaya, namun pengelolaannya masih menghadapi masalah serius seperti alih fungsi lahan, infrastruktur terbatas, dan rendahnya partisipasi masyarakat. Penelitian ini bertujuan merumuskan model perencanaan tata ruang berbasis zonasi partisipatif untuk mendukung pengembangan heritage education tourism. Metode yang digunakan adalah kualitatif deskriptif melalui observasi, wawancara, diskusi kelompok, serta telaah dokumen regulasi dan literatur. Analisis SWOT dan pendekatan spasial digunakan untuk mengidentifikasi potensi, kendala, serta penyusunan zonasi sesuai prinsip pelestarian, edukasi, dan pemberdayaan masyarakat. Hasil penelitian menunjukkan bahwa delineasi empat zona yaitu zona inti, zona penyangga, zona pengembangan, dan zona penunjang dapat meningkatkan efisiensi pengelolaan ruang. Selain itu, integrasi UMKM lokal (lidi nipah, madu kelulut/pelawan, dan kerang darah) dalam zona penunjang membuka peluang pemberdayaan ekonomi yang memperkuat partisipasi masyarakat. Kebaruan (novelty) penelitian ini terletak pada pengembangan model tata ruang partisipatif yang menggabungkan konservasi sejarah, fungsi edukatif, dan ekonomi kreatif masyarakat di kawasan cagar budaya pulau kecil. Secara teoretis, penelitian ini memperkaya literatur heritage planning dengan pendekatan spasial-edukatif-partisipatif, sedangkan secara praktis memberikan rekomendasi kebijakan untuk mewujudkan pengelolaan cagar budaya yang inklusif, adaptif, dan berkelanjutan.
